At present, there are no direct flights from Jeju City to Jakarta.
However, there are several flights from CJU to CGK with a stopover.

Jakarta is a tropical destination known for its warm climate, with temperatures between 25°C and 30°C (77°F to 86°F) throughout the year. The area is characterized by high humidity and frequent rainfall.
Since Jakarta is situated south of the equator, the dry season runs from May to October. This makes it the ideal time to visit. During these months, you can expect mostly dry weather, while the wet season can bring days of rain. Temperatures remain high year-round, along with high humidity levels.

You can fly the full journey from CJU to CGK in either Economy or Business Class. Premium Economy and First Class are not available on this route, at least not on the full route with just 1 stopover.
However, for the first part of this route, Economy and Business Class are available. This depends on the stopover airport of your choice though.
Again depending on your stopover airport, available classes for the second part of this route are Economy, Premium Economy, Business or First Class.

The distance between Jeju City and Jakarta is 3,035 miles (4,884 kilometers).
However, because there are no direct flights between CJU and CGK, the distance of the full journey varies between 3,029 and 4,429 miles (or 4,875 and 7,128 kilometers), depending on your stopover airport.
Flights from Jeju City to Jakarta take from 7 hours and 50 minutes up to 10 hours and 25 minutes, depending on your stopover airport.
Please note that these times refer to the actual flight times, excluding the stopover time in between connecting flights, as this depends on your stopover airport as well as your date(s) of travel.
There are 2 airports in Jakarta: Soekarno–Hatta International Airport (CGK) and Halim Perdanakusuma International Airport (HLP).
